TOKYO, Aug. 6 (Xinhua) -- Circuit breaker on Tuesday halted futures trading of Japan's benchmark Nikkei 225 Index, as Tokyo stocks saw sharp rebound after Monday's rout.
As of 9:30 a.m. local time, the 225-issue Nikkei Stock Average gained 8.02 percent, or 2,522.03 points, following its record intraday losses on Monday.
Futures trading of Tokyo Stock Exchange Growth Market 250 Index also saw suspension due to circuit breaker. Enditem
